Golden Buddha by Binary Selections

Ruderalis × Indica × Sativa

Golden Buddha is a hybrid cannabis strain developed by Binary Selections, notable for its unique genetic makeup. It was bred to combine desirable traits from ruderalis, indica, and sativa varieties, resulting in a resilient and versatile cultivar. This strain offers a balanced experience, appealing to both cultivators and consumers.

Appearance

Golden Buddha presents visually striking buds characterized by dense, conical structures and a vibrant color palette. These buds often display a mix of deep greens with luminous golden hues, further enhanced by sparkling trichomes. The morphology reflects a blend of indica and sativa traits, with medium to large sizes and prominent amber or yellow pistils, contributing to its attractive presentation.

The strain's genetic incorporation of ruderalis contributes to a compact and robust structure, making it suitable for various growing environments. The distinctive golden accents, observed in a significant portion of buds, enhance its overall aesthetic appeal and align with its evocative name.

Aroma & Flavor

The aroma of Golden Buddha is a complex bouquet, featuring a robust earthy base interwoven with distinct notes of citrus and tropical fruits. This multi-layered scent profile evokes images of a serene garden, combining earthy undertones with brighter, uplifting fragrances. Initial whiffs often reveal musky, earthy notes that gradually transition into aromatic layers reminiscent of lemon and tangerine.

Mirroring its aroma, the flavor profile begins with a bright citrus burst, characterized by tangy and subtly sweet notes. This is followed by a more pronounced earthy finish, complemented by hints of pine and spice. Users often describe the taste as a harmonious blend, akin to a refreshing herbal tea with citrus and pine undertones, leaving a pleasant and lingering earthy aftertaste.

Effects

Golden Buddha is known for delivering a balanced set of effects, stemming from its hybrid genetics. It is reported to promote a sense of calm and focus, making it suitable for various activities. The strain offers a psychoactive experience that is generally not overwhelming, providing a gentle lift and a clear-headed sensation.

Consumers often turn to Golden Buddha for its ability to alleviate feelings of anxiety and stress. Its well-rounded effects contribute to a relaxed yet mentally engaged state, making it a versatile choice for both daytime and evening use, depending on individual tolerance and desired outcomes.

Terpenes & Cannabinoids

While specific terpene and cannabinoid percentages can vary, Golden Buddha is noted for its potential to contain compounds such as Myrcene, Limonene, and Caryophyllene. These terpenes contribute to the strain's characteristic aroma and flavor profile, influencing its sensory experience. The interplay of these aromatic compounds creates a complex and appealing scent and taste.

The cannabinoid profile of Golden Buddha typically features THC levels around 18% to 25%, offering a moderate to strong psychoactive effect. Its CBD content is generally less than 1%, indicating that its primary effects are driven by THC. This cannabinoid balance contributes to its reputation as a well-rounded hybrid.

Growing

Golden Buddha is a hybrid strain that incorporates ruderalis genetics, contributing to its resilience and potentially faster maturation times. Its balanced genetic background suggests adaptability to various growing conditions, though specific cultivation details like optimal flowering times and yield potentials would depend on the grower's methods and environment. The presence of ruderalis may also influence its growth structure, potentially leading to more compact plants.

Origins & Lineage

Golden Buddha was meticulously developed by Binary Selections through a selective breeding program aimed at integrating the best traits from ruderalis, indica, and sativa landraces. This effort sought to create a modern hybrid that is robust, resilient, and possesses a unique genetic heritage. The breeders combined the hardiness of ruderalis, the calming properties of indica, and the uplifting energy of sativa.

This deliberate crossbreeding process resulted in a versatile cultivar that honors legacy cannabis genetics while incorporating contemporary breeding techniques. The strain stands as a testament to the potential of diverse lineage incorporation in cannabis, aiming for enhanced yield, cannabinoid content, and adaptability, aligning with modern breeding trends.
